BEAUTIFUL FRAME UP RESTORED, REAL X22 CODE SUPER SPORT CONVERTIBLE. REBUILT DRIVETRAIN, NEW TOP, PAINT, AND INTERIOR. SHOW DETAILED THROUGHOUT.

EXTERIOR: Laser straight, all steel Tennessee body. No patch panels. Fit on all panels is precise and uniform. Body was stripped to bare metal. Fresh factory correct Code 57 Fathom Green Base Coat/Clear Coat paint. Finish is smooth, uniform, and buffed to a mirror gloss. Correct White Hockey Stripes. New White convertible top with new plastic rear window and White boot. All glass is in excellent condition. New front and rear bumpers. Front and rear spoilers. New door handles, emblems, mirrors, stainless trim, wheelhouse moldings, and grill. Factory SS hood with new chrome louvers. N66 Super Sport wheels have been media blasted and refinished. New P225/70R14 radial tires on all four corners.

DRIVETRAIN: Show quality engine bay. The original big block was replaced with a totally rebuilt 396-325 HP block assembled 3/29/68. Rochester Quadro- Jet carburetor mounted atop stock cast iron intake manifold. Chrome open element air cleaner and valve covers. Oval Port heads. Delco- Remy ignition. Stock exhaust manifolds attached to full Flowmaster Exhaust. Brand new heavy duty radiator. New hoses, clamps, fasteners, etc. Clutch fan and full shroud. The original big block heater core is still mounted on the firewall. Power Steering. Power Disc Brakes with proportioning valve. Engine runs as good as it looks.

Rebuilt Turbo Automatic transmission. Twelve bolt rear differential. Undercarraige is painted in 30* Gloss Black. Nicely detailed, and with this undercarriage, you can drive the car without hours of constant cleaning. All floor pans are original, straight, and rust free. New fuel tank. Upgrades and maintenance were performed on the chassis and suspension as needed.

INTERIOR: Parchment and Black Houndstooth bucket seat interior. Seat covers and cushions are brand new. New dash pad. Door panels, carpet, sill plates, seals, weatherstripping, jam seals, and window fuzzies are also new. Console and stirrup shifter in excellent condition. Super Sport steering wheel. Interior chrome handles and trim pieces have been replaced. Kenwood AM/FM/Cassette. Power Top.

TRUNK: Original inner quarters are clean and rust free. Trunk floor is solid and spotless. Complete trunk area freshly finished in splatter paint. Original Cocktail Shakers still in their place of support in the rear trunk corners. New trunk seal.
